Изменения
→Псевдокод
    '''int''' n = s.length
    '''int''' m = w.length
    '''int''' hashS = hash(s[10..m-1])    '''int''' hashW = hash(w[10..m-1])    '''for''' i = 1 0 '''to''' n - m + 1
         '''if''' hashS == hashW
              answer.add(i)
Новый хеш <tex>hashS</tex> был получен с помощью быстрого пересчёта. Для сохранения корректности алгоритма нужно считать, что <tex>s[n + 1]</tex> {{---}} пустой символ.
===Время работы===
